Section 55.9(1)

When the court decides the track for a possession claim, the matters to which it shall have regard include— the matters set out in rule 26.13 as modified by the relevant practice direction; the amount of any arrears of rent or mortgage instalments; the importance to the defendant of retaining possession of the land; ... the importance of vacant possession to the claimant ; and if applicable, the alleged conduct of the defendant
